The monad method for specifying the reference system is used to examine the Schiff effect arising in the motion of a rotating body along a ballistic trajectory in a Schwarzschild field. A general formula for calculating the precession angle in the accompanying reference system is presented. As examples the motions of a gyroscope in parabolic, elliptical, and hyperbolic orbits is considered.
